Catster Photo Contest: Cats of the Week Winners (October 25, 2024)

Georgie Winner Oct 25

This Week’s Winner

Georgie Winner

Name: Georgie Wigglesworth
Breed: Silver Tabby
Fun Fact: She was the smallest but only survivor of her litter. Owner had to feed her with a syringe because she was too tiny to fit the kitten bottle nipple into her mouth. She is now 2.
